What Are Anti-Hacking Laws?

Anti-hacking laws are legal provisions enacted to prevent unauthorized access to computer systems, networks, and data. These laws typically criminalize activities such as accessing a system without permission, altering or destroying data, and using a computer to commit fraud or espionage. Many countries have developed comprehensive frameworks to deter cybercriminals, with some specific laws targeting hacking tools and methods, while others address the consequences of cyber-attacks on victims.

One of the primary goals of anti-hacking laws is to provide a legal basis for prosecuting hackers and holding them accountable for their actions. However, given the constantly evolving nature of cybercrime, these laws are frequently updated to address new technologies, tactics, and threats.

Key Elements of Anti-Hacking Laws

  1. Unauthorized Access: Most anti-hacking laws focus on unauthorized access to computer systems. This includes accessing a computer system or network without permission, bypassing security protocols, or gaining access by deceitful means, such as phishing attacks.

  2. Data Theft or Destruction: Many laws also address the theft, alteration, or destruction of data. Hacking into a system to steal confidential information or corrupt files can result in severe penalties under these laws.

  3. Malware Distribution: Anti-hacking legislation often targets the distribution of malicious software, such as viruses, worms, and ransomware. These programs are designed to infiltrate systems, steal data, or cause disruption.

  4. Computer Fraud: Fraudulent activities that involve the use of computers, such as online banking fraud, credit card theft, or identity theft, are covered under anti-hacking laws. Cybercriminals who use hacking techniques to manipulate financial transactions can face criminal charges.

  5. Cyberterrorism: Some laws also extend to activities aimed at using cyberattacks for political, ideological, or social purposes, such as cyberterrorism or cyber warfare. These attacks may target governments, public institutions, or critical infrastructure.

Notable Anti-Hacking Laws Worldwide

  1. The Computer Fraud and Abuse Act (CFAA) - United States: Enacted in 1986, the CFAA is one of the most well-known anti-hacking laws in the U.S. It criminalizes unauthorized access to computer systems, including government, financial, and commercial systems. The law has been amended several times to address emerging threats, including hacking and identity theft.

  2. The Cybercrime Prevention Act of 2012 - Philippines: This law criminalizes a wide range of cybercrimes, including hacking, online fraud, identity theft, and cyberbullying. It aims to address the growing threat of cybercrime and strengthen the country’s digital security infrastructure.

  3. The General Data Protection Regulation (GDPR) - European Union: While not an anti-hacking law in itself, the GDPR has a significant impact on the way organizations protect personal data. It mandates that companies implement robust security measures to safeguard data, and failure to do so can result in heavy penalties if the data is compromised due to hacking.

  4. The Computer Misuse Act 1990 - United Kingdom: This law makes unauthorized access to computer systems a criminal offense, and it also covers offenses related to hacking, distributing malware, and accessing computer systems with the intent to commit fraud.

  5. The Cybersecurity Law of the People's Republic of China: Enacted in 2017, this law focuses on improving national security and the protection of Chinese citizens' personal data. It mandates that organizations maintain strong cybersecurity practices and cooperate with government authorities in the event of a cyberattack.

Challenges in Enforcing Anti-Hacking Laws

While anti-hacking laws are essential for safeguarding digital spaces, enforcing these laws presents several challenges:

  1. Jurisdiction Issues: Cybercrimes often transcend national borders, making it difficult to apply laws effectively. Hackers can operate from any part of the world, targeting victims in different countries, which complicates prosecution and enforcement efforts.

  2. Rapid Technological Advancements: The fast-paced evolution of technology means that hackers continuously adapt and develop new techniques to bypass security measures. Anti-hacking laws must evolve in tandem with technological innovations to remain effective.

  3. Encryption and Anonymity: The use of encryption and anonymizing tools such as VPNs or the dark web makes it more challenging to identify and apprehend cybercriminals. These tools allow hackers to hide their identities and locations, making it harder for authorities to track them down.

  4. Lack of International Cooperation: Given the global nature of hacking, international cooperation is crucial in combating cybercrime. However, legal, political, and diplomatic challenges often hinder collaborative efforts between countries, which limits the effectiveness of anti-hacking laws.
